您的位置: 网站首页> IT爱问> 当前文章

JDK 8中引入的Parallel Streams如何提升数据处理性能?

老董2024-04-21155围观,145赞

  1、自动并行化: Parallel Streams通过将一个任务分割成多个子任务,然后并行处理这些子任务,最后将结果合并,从而实现自动的数据并行处理。这一过程对开发者来说是透明的,大大简化了并行代码的编写。

  2、利用多核处理器: 在多核处理器上运行时,Parallel Streams能够显著提高应用程序处理数据的速度。它通过Fork/Join框架有效地利用了系统中的所有可用核心。

  3、减少执行时间: 对于大量数据的处理任务,使用Parallel Streams可以减少执行时间,尤其是在执行复杂的计算密集型操作时。

  4、灵活性和易用性: Parallel Streams提供了与普通Streams相同的API,使得将串行流转换为并行流变得非常简单,只需改变一个方法调用即可。

  本文就此结束,感谢IT人士的关注JDK 8中引入的Parallel Streams如何提升数据处理性能?,本文合作企业直达:更多推荐

  本文就此结束,感谢IT人士的关注JDK 8中引入的Parallel Streams如何提升数据处理性能?,本文合作企业直达:更多推荐

很赞哦!

python编程网提示:转载请注明来源www.python66.com。
有宝贵意见可添加站长微信(底部),获取技术资料请到公众号(底部)。同行交流请加群 python学习会

文章评论

    JDK 8中引入的Parallel Streams如何提升数据处理性能?文章写得不错,值得赞赏

站点信息

  • 网站程序:Laravel
  • 客服微信:a772483200